an upper motor neuron lesion to the spinal accessory and hypoglossal nerve will cause?
ipsilateral head rotation and ipsilateral tongue deviation
contralateral head rotation and ipsilateral tongue deviation
ipsilateral head rotation and contralateral tongue deviation
contralateral head rotation and contralateral tongue deviation

Explanation:

Brief Explanations
  • The spinal accessory nerve (CN XI) innervates the sternocleidomastoid and trapezius muscles. The sternocleidomastoid muscle, when acting alone, rotates the head to the opposite (contralateral) side.
  • The hypoglossal nerve (CN XII) innervates the tongue muscles. In an upper motor neuron lesion of the hypoglossal nerve, the tongue deviates to the contralateral side due to the unopposed action of the intact genioglossus muscle on the healthy side.

Answer:

Contralateral head rotation and contralateral tongue deviation
